Prioritizing Patient Well-being: Anti-Ligature Clock Designs
In healthcare settings, ensuring patient safety is paramount. One crucial aspect concerns the elimination of potential ligature hazards. Clocks, often found in patient rooms, can pose a risk if they contain standard mounting hardware that could be used for self-harm. To address this challenge, innovative anti-ligature clock solutions have emerged. These innovations feature secure mounting mechanisms that prevent the removal of the clock face or hands, thereby minimizing the risk of ligature-related incidents.
Anti-ligature clocks are fabricated from durable materials and incorporate unique features to enhance patient safety. They may include tamper-resistant designs, concealed mounting hardware, and non-protruding surfaces. By implementing these security measures, healthcare facilities can create a protective environment for patients.{
